### Step 2: Rebuild the tax cache

Security note: the old Ratewren cache stored lookup responses unencrypted on local disk. The new version keeps entries in memory only and signs upstream responses before trusting them. Flush the old cache directory entirely before starting the new service — don't migrate files. The replacement cache boots with these settings:

deployment values, yadug-bawif:
[framir]
team = pelox
access_code = ac_a38ab2
owner = tamion.julael
host = framir.tolvaqlabs.test
port = 11211
peer = tammir.zemvargrid.local
salt = 2215ef03
pin = 1541

A schema change in the `orders_ledger` service attempted a blocking ALTER during peak traffic; the Driftgate migration runner halted it automatically. No data was modified. Maintainers: all migrations must use the expand-contract pattern and pass the Driftgate dry-run check before deploy. Do not disable the guard flag to force the change through. Review the halted migration, split it into non-blocking steps, and re-submit. For questions about guard configuration, write to the address below.

escalation mailbox, bafog-fafog: ulador@paliqlabs.internal

Shuttle-Bus Gate — Facilities Desk Notes

The shuttle-bus gate at the Quillstone Annex opens automatically for registered shuttles between 06:30 and 19:00. Outside those hours, the driver must stop at the keypad pillar on the left side of the approach lane. Facilities desk staff are responsible for confirming the gate schedule each Monday. For after-hours manual entry, use the code below.

turnstile pass: bdg-QZV-3

Second-Source Supplier Search — Orviton Components (Managers Only)

This page summarises the ongoing search for a second source for the Orviton valve assemblies currently supplied solely by Kestlewood Manufacturing. Three candidates have passed initial quality screening; two can meet volume requirements within six months. Tooling transfer costs remain the main open issue. The incoming director should review the shortlist scoring before the next supplier visit. Strategic context is provided in the note below.

management briefing: Project Ulavan slips by two quarters because of the staffing delay.